About Clinton Counseling Center – Mount Clemens
Clinton Counseling Center provides substance abuse and mental health treatment for adults. You’ll find them out in Clemens, Michigan. They offer intensive outpatient (IOP) and general outpatient services (OP). This way, you’ll get flexibility if you want to live at home and continue working or attending school while getting treatment.
An assessment will help the team decide the appropriate level of care for your needs. Each person receives a customized treatment plan.
Your main course of treatment will be group and individual therapy. With a group, you can learn from others’ experiences and gain a support group who’ll stay with you throughout your program. They can even be there after you graduate. In any case, you’ll learn about your triggers and find new ways of coping in healthy ways.
Medication management is available to help with withdrawal symptoms and other issues during treatment, like anxiety or depression.
Case management is available to provide guidance and connect you to outside agencies or resources for ongoing recovery support. Case managers may assist with housing, healthcare, transportation to and from treatment, and referrals for higher-level care.
Family therapy may help loved ones understand how the disease of addiction works and how it affects relationships. They can set appropriate boundaries and learn healthy communication skills to be a support network for continued sobriety.
